“…In addition, another study, that of Sari et al 30 , on the BsmI polymorphism aimed to evaluate the effect of vitamin D supplementation in women from North Sumatra, Indonesia, aged 20-50 years, with a BMI of 23 kg/m 2 (overweight, according to the Asia Pacific guidelines by Gill) 31 . The type of capsule used for supplementation had a variation in gel consistency, being pink and hard for the placebo group (n= 17), and soft and yellow for the group receiving vitamin D 3 (n= 19).…”
